无法在 Linux Mint 18 上运行 Elasticsearch

无法在 Linux Mint 18 上运行 Elasticsearch

我在 Linux Mint 上安装了 Elasticsearch,没有遇到任何问题。

一切按照本教程进行在 Ubuntu 14.04 上轻松安装 elasticsearch

所有安装步骤都很顺利。但是,当我想运行简单检查时:

卷曲http://本地主机:9200

我有:

nazar@lelyak-desktop:~$ curl -X GET 'http://localhost:9200'
curl: (7) Failed to connect to localhost port 9200: Connection refused

电脑重启没有帮助。

如何解决这个问题?

答案1

遵循官方文档这里而不是那个链接的要点 - 它指的是非常旧的 ES 版本。设置最近的 deb 存储库:

echo "deb https://artifacts.elastic.co/packages/6.x/apt stable main" | sudo tee -a /etc/apt/sources.list.d/elastic-6.x.list

并通过 apt 安装。

答案2

进入终端并执行:

sudo service elasticsearch start

相关内容